PRESENT SIMPLE AND PRESENT CONTINUOUS

1 Complete the sentences with the verbs in brackets. Use the Present Simple or Present Continuous.
1. Adults always (think) that they (know) everything.
2. It (rain) right now so we (wear) our new boots.
3. I (not want) to watch a film because I (write) a book report.
4. Mum (not usually allow) us to stay out late at night. Thats why we (go) home now.
5. Mary, I (not understand) what you (say).

5 Choose the correct answer.
1. What are you cooking? It smells / is smelling wonderful.
2. What time do you usually go / are you usually going to bed?
3. Be quiet! The baby sleeps / is sleeping.
4. How often do you visit / are you visiting your grandmother?
5. In most US schools, the students dont wear / arent wearing uniforms.
6. You dont need an umbrella this morning. It doesnt rain / isnt raining.
7. He is a vegetarian. He doesnt eat / isnt eating meat.
